About

None of the households in Gresham Park, GA reported speaking a non-English language at home as their primary shared language. This does not consider the potential multi-lingual nature of households, but only the primary self-reported language spoken by all members of the household.

95.6% of the residents in Gresham Park, GA are U.S. citizens.

In 2024, the median property value in Gresham Park, GA was $297,800, and the homeownership rate was 65.7%.

Most people in Gresham Park, GA drove alone to work, and the average commute time was 29.4 minutes. The average car ownership in Gresham Park, GA was 2 cars per household.

Economy

The economy of Gresham Park, GA employs 3.42k people. In 2024, the largest industries in Gresham Park, GA were Public Administration (547 people), Retail Trade (403 people), and Health Care & Social Assistance (333 people), and the highest paying industries were Finance & Insurance ($123,155), Finance & Insurance, & Real Estate & Rental & Leasing ($100,125), and Professional, Scientific, & Technical Services ($84,091).

Civics

In the 2024 presidential election, the popular vote in Georgia went to Donald J. Trump with 50.7% of the vote. The runner-up was Kamala Harris (48.5%), followed by Chase Oliver (0.394%).

Jon Ossoff and Raphael Warnock are the senators currently representing the state of Georgia. In the United States, senators are elected to 6-year terms with the terms for individual senators staggered.

Georgia is currently represented by 14 members in the U.S. house, and members of the House of Representives are elected to 2-year terms.

Housing & Living

The median property value in Gresham Park, GA was $297,800 in 2024, which is 0.895 times smaller than the national average of $332,700. Between 2023 and 2024 the median property value increased from $261,800 to $297,800, a 13.8% increase. The homeownership rate in Gresham Park, GA is 65.7%, which is higher than the national average of 65.2%.

People in Gresham Park, GA have an average commute time of 29.4 minutes, and they drove alone to work. Car ownership in Gresham Park, GA is approximately the same as the national average, with an average of 2 cars per household.

Poverty & Diversity

19.5% of the population for whom poverty status is determined in Gresham Park, GA (1.35k out of 6.94k people) live below the poverty line, a number that is higher than the national average of 12.5%. The largest demographic living in poverty are Males < 5, followed by Females 35 - 44 and then Males 35 - 44.

The most common racial or ethnic group living below the poverty line in Gresham Park, GA is Black, followed by Two Or More and Hispanic.

The Census Bureau uses a set of money income thresholds that vary by family size and composition to determine who classifies as impoverished. If a family's total income is less than the family's threshold than that family and every individual in it is considered to be living in poverty.

Health

90.6% of the population of Gresham Park, GA has health coverage, with 40.5% on employee plans, 21.9% on Medicaid, 14.4% on Medicare, 11.6% on non-group plans, and 2.18% on military or VA plans.

Primary care physicians in Georgia see 1,517 patients per year on average, which represents a 0% change from the previous year (1,517 patients). Compare this to dentists who see 1856 patients per year, and mental health providers who see 525 patients per year.

By gender, of the total number of insured persons, 52.2% were men and 47.8% were women.
